The single wall corrugated pipe extrusion machine consists of
several machines in a production line. The main machines typically
include:
1.Extruder: The extruder is the core machine in the production
line. It melts and homogenizes the raw material, usually
high-density polyethylene (HDPE), and then forces it through a die
to form the desired shape.
2.Corrugator: The corrugator is responsible for creating the
corrugated structure of the pipe. It consists of a set of rotating
molds that shape the molten plastic into the desired corrugated
profile. The molds are cooled to solidify the plastic, and the
formed corrugated pipe is then pulled through the corrugator.
3.Forming Machine: The forming machine is used to shape the
corrugated pipe into the desired diameter and length. It may
include modules for cutting, cooling, and stacking the pipes.
4.Winding Machine: The winding machine is used to coil the finished
corrugated pipes onto reels or spools. It facilitates easy storage,
transportation, and further processing of the pipes.
The extrusion process of the extruder involves the following steps:
1.Material Preparation: The raw material, usually HDPE pellets, is
fed into the hopper of the extruder.
2.Melting and Homogenization: The material is heated and melted
inside the extruder barrel. The rotating screw inside the barrel
conveys the molten plastic while homogenizing it to ensure
consistent properties.
3.Extrusion and Shaping: The molten plastic is forced through a
die, which gives it the shape of a continuous pipe. The die is
designed to create the desired corrugated structure.
4.Cooling and Solidification: The newly formed corrugated pipe
passes through a cooling system, often using water or air, to
solidify the plastic.
5.Pulling and Cutting: The corrugated pipe is pulled through the
production line by the haul-off machine at a constant speed. It may
be cut into desired lengths at this stage.
Advantages of the extrusion machine:
1.High Efficiency: The extrusion machine enables continuous
production, resulting in high output rates and improved
productivity.
2.Flexibility: The machine can be adjusted to produce single wall
corrugated pipes of different sizes, diameters, and lengths,
catering to various application requirements.
3.Cost-effectiveness: By automating the production process, the
extrusion machine reduces labor costs and minimizes material
wastage, making it a cost-effective solution.
4.Quality Control: The machine ensures consistent quality as it
maintains precise control over parameters such as temperature,
pressure, and speed during the extrusion process.
5.Durability: The extrusion machine is constructed with robust
materials, allowing it to withstand the demands of continuous
operation and provide long-term reliability.
